Precision Business Tech Salary

How Much Does Precision Business Tech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average weekly salary for employees at Precision Business Tech in the United States is $854.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$44,402. Salaries at Precision Business Tech typically range from $740 to $941 weekly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Precision Business Tech’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Raleigh?

Understanding the cost of living near Raleigh is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Precision Business Tech.
Raleigh's Cost of Living Index is approximately 102.3 (2.3% more expensive than US average; 6.6% more than NC average). State capital, Research Triangle Park, tech hub, housing above US avg. GoRaleigh/GoTriangle. When planning your budget based on a salary from Precision Business Tech,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,100+ A significant portion of Precision Business Tech sal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(GoRaleigh mon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$430 - $780+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,830 - $4,410+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
